(BIBLE IN GREEK.) Novum Testamentum Graecum. Half-title and title ruled in red. [20], 168; [2], 632 pages. 2 parts in one volume. Folio, 418x252 mm, modern leather; marginal dampstaining through most of volume, mainly conspicuous on opening leaves, moderate foxing. Leipzig: sons of Johann Friedrich Gleditsch, 1723

Additional Details

First published in 1707, "perhaps the most famous Greek Testament of the eighteenth century" (Darlow & Moule), edited by John Mills, who added a critical apparatus containing variant readings from nearly 100 manuscripts. Darlow & Moule 4735.
